1、Cognitive ISO 26262: Global Common Criteria for Automotive Functional Safety

1. Core Definitions of Standards

ISO 26262, derived from IEC 61508, is a functional safety standard specifically designed for the automotive industry. First published in 2011 and updated with its second edition in 2018, it has now become the globally recognized guideline for road vehicle safety development in the automotive sector.

This standard is not a standalone technical specification, but a comprehensive safety engineering framework that spans the entire lifecycle of automotive E/E systems—from conceptual design and development integration to production, operation, maintenance, and decommissioning. It provides end-to-end guidance and standards for functional safety in automotive electronic and electrical systems.

2. Core Values of Certification

image.png


The ISO 26262 certification establishes the Automotive Safety Integrity Level (ASIL) classification system, ranging from QM (Basic Quality Requirements) to five levels: ASIL A, B, C, and D, with ASIL D representing the highest safety standard. Critical safety systems such as airbags and power steering must meet this stringent level. Each level requires differentiated development rigor and verification completeness, driving enterprises to transition from a reactive 'post-incident repair' mindset to a proactive 'pre-incident prevention' safety culture.

2、Three Major Obstacles on the Road of Enterprise Certification

image.png


The ISO 26262 certification is not merely a procedural adjustment, but a profound transformation of an enterprise's core R&D system. Numerous practical challenges have deterred many companies from pursuing it.

1. high cost of resource input

Building a professional safety team, implementing supporting toolchains, and conducting systematic training for all staff are essential. Even the initial establishment of a standardized system requires significant time and human resource investment.

2. Deep barriers to cross-departmental collaboration

The design, development, testing, quality control, and procurement departments must collaborate across boundaries under a unified security framework, posing significant challenges to the company's existing organizational structure and corporate culture.

3. Technical specialty requires precision

Professional methodologies including safety requirement analysis, fault tree analysis, and failure mode and effects analysis, along with comprehensive safety lifecycle management, all require profound expertise and extensive industry experience.
